Submission of documents for the Schengen visa

The list of documents for the Schengen visa is quite large. Firstly, you need a passport, and its validity must be at least three months longer than the term of the visa that you request. Secondly, it is necessary to have a document confirming the purpose and nature of the trip, it can be a reserved place in the hotel. Thirdly, you will need to confirm the availability of funds for such a journey, for this purpose, a salary certificate and a special statement on the purchase of currency for a specific amount are taken. Fourth, to make a photo for a visa should be in accordance with the requirements of a certain consulate, which will subsequently issue you a visa.

Where to make a Schengen visa, you understand. Before you go to the consulate of the country you need, you can download the application form and fill it in on the official website of the consulates. If you do not have a computer with access to the World Wide Web, then you'll have to go for the form. Please note that it is necessary to fill out the questionnaire as accurately as possible, because in the future you will need to confirm this information with the help of appropriate certificates and seals.

When you visit the consulate with the completed application form and the required documents, apply. Be logical when submitting documents. A hotel room booked for three days can not be the reason for issuing a visa for a period of 6 months. A plausible and weighty reason for visiting the country will do you a good job, but keep in mind that you will be asked to present a medical policy confirming the possibility of medical care abroad to obtain a monthly visa. You should apply for a visa at the consulate of the country that will become your main place of residence, as well as enter the territory subject to the Schengen agreement best through the country in which you have issued your documents at the consulate. Observance of all the above rules and requirements will ensure that you will easily get a visa in the future, whereas violation of one of the conditions may well be the reason for refusing to issue a visa.

Terms of receipt and cost

You can make a visa and urgently, but in this case its cost will increase by about 30%. so before you quickly make a visa, make sure that you do not have any opportunity to wait for the necessary time and get it without any overpayments. The length of the procedure can be from one to two weeks, depending on the chosen country. The total cost of a visa varies depending on which country you are going to go to. In addition to paying the principal, you will also need to pay a consular fee, which is for each consulate its amount.
